Topcon in Italian dealer acquisition

31 August 2012

Surveying and GPS positioning equipment manufacturer Topcon Europe Positioning has acquired a controlling stake in its long-standing Italian dealer Geotop.

Geotop, which became a Topcon distributor in 1980 and started distributing the manufacturer's Sokkia product line in 2011, owns more than 200 global navigation satellite systems (GNSS) reference stations in Italy, creating NetGEO, one of Europe's largest GNSS networks.

As well as owning five service centres and a monitoring centre in Italy, it also has a software company, GeoPro, which develops software for GNSS, geographical intelligent survey (GIS), monitoring and total station applications.

Geotop joins four other companies that Topcon owns in Italy - Topcon Tierra, Topcon Infomobility and GeoPro.

Ivan Di Federico, president and CEO of Geotop Italy, said, "The addition of Geotop not only adds to Topcon's presence in Italy, but emphasises the synergistic opportunities we have with all companies working closely together to provide products and services to customers and potential customers."

The news comes after rival surveying and GPS positioning equipment manufacturer Trimble earlier this month expanded its presence in the US with the acquisition of software provider TMW Systems US$ 335 million.
